The Grafenwhr Training Area (GTA) was created following the activation of the III Royal Bavarian Corps in 1900 and in 1908, the training area was officially designated as "Training Area Grafenwhr". additional 12,000 acres were added. In 1988, Hohenfels became the home of the Combat Maneuver Training Center (CMTC), the mission of which was to provide realistic combined arms training for the United States Army, Europe, and Seventh Armys maneuver battalion task forces in force-on-force exercises. Jesse Moore (front) and U.S. Army Sgt. Exercises revolved around the fictional nation of Danubia and its three provinces of friendly Sowenia, hostile Vilslakia, and neutral Jursland. Covering over 40,000 acres, Hohenfels is the largest combat maneuver training area available to US troops in Europe. From 1956 to 1988, the Hohenfels Training Area was used by NATO forces consisting primarily of American, German, Canadian, and occasionally British and French forces. Lager Pllnricht). Challenging the U.S. and multinational forces that rotate through the Hohenfels Training Area for Allied Spirit VIII may seem like a daunting task for the 1-4, which is the Joint Multinational Readiness Center's world-class opposing force, but it is a task the unit takes very seriously. The town is host to the United States Army Garrison Hohenfels, which operates the Joint Multinational Readiness Center for training NATO armed forces.
